Hours before, Gorman and music director/disc jockey Denny Sanders -- two key figures who would play a key role in turning WMMS from an obscure FM station to an industry influencer and Cleveland treasure -- racked their brains about creating a station mascot.
“You’re faced with this negativity day and night about Cleveland,” Gorman said. “Everybody was telling me Cleveland was dying. Meanwhile, I see Cleveland from a different light. It has a great park system. It’s a great rock ‘n’ roll town. It’s got potential.” The day after driving home in the sleet and snow, Gorman told Sanders about the buzzard mascot when the mail was delivered to WMMS, which at the time was located on Euclid Avenue and E. 55th in the building that now houses the Cleveland Agora.
An avid WMMS listener who also looked like the quintessential fan , Helton on a whim mailed a complaint letter to the station. “He said, ‘A buzzard is a scavenger and we’re trying to scavenge the best of Cleveland and put it together on a radio station.’” “All I could think about is old Buzz Buzzard from the Walter Lantz cartoons, but that’s not what I used as a reference. I remembered a buzzard’s long, skinny neck from biology books in high school. So I went home and drew it. That’s how it came out.”“It was a tough bird for a tough city,” Sanders said. “David’s rendition was also friendly and smiling. It showed the two sides of Cleveland....tough but friendly.
“It forced the issue and finally convinced corporate we should do a bumper sticker with the Buzzard on it. That came out late spring and early summer of 1974. A number of things fell into place that made the Buzzard work.”
